Exploring 6-[3-Hydroxy-2-(hydroxymethyl)propyl]-5-methyl-1H-pyrimidine-2,4-dione
6-[3-Hydroxy-2-(hydroxymethyl)propyl]-5-methyl-1H-pyrimidine-2,4-dione, with its complex structure, is a fascinating compound in the realm of organic chemistry. Here are some intriguing facts about this compound:
- Biological Significance: This pyrimidine derivative is known to possess biological activity, which has made it a subject of interest in medicinal chemistry.
- Structural Attributes: The presence of both hydroxy and hydroxymethyl groups within its structure contributes to its diverse reactivity and potential applications.
- Potential Drug Development: Due to its structural components, there is ongoing research into its potential use in pharmaceutical applications, particularly in the development of new therapeutic agents.
- Complex Chemistry: The multifunctional nature of this compound allows for various chemical transformations, which makes it an excellent candidate for synthetic organic chemistry exploration.
- Historical Context: Compounds like this one are often explored for their role in biological processes, such as enzyme regulation and as intermediates in metabolic pathways.
